Have you ever talked to a computer? No? Then try it with the Calliope mini!

"Calliope mini" is a single-board computer that can be programmed to solve hardware problems, implement ideas, and create fun projects. Programming is done simply with colorful blocks in the MakeCode programming environment - then the computer will understand what you want to say.
